AlPO4; AlPO-34 (Al[PO4] -34, T = 160 K) Crystal Structure
General Information
- Phase Label(s): Al[PO4] -34
- Structure Class(es): zeolite CHA
- Classification by Properties: negative thermal expansion NTE
- Mineral Name(s): –
- Pearson Symbol: hR108
- Space Group: 148
- Phase Prototype: Al[PO4]-b
- Measurement Detail(s): automatic diffractometer (determination of cell parameters), automatic diffractometer; France, Grenoble, European Synchrotron Radiation Facility ESRF, ID31 (determination of structural parameters), X-rays, synchrotron; λ = 0.080007 nm (determination of cell and structural parameters), T = 160 K (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): orthophosphate
- Interpretation Detail(s): complete structure determined; temperature dependence studied, Rietveld refinement, RP = 0.0990; wRP = 0.1208; RB = 0.0343
- Sample Detail(s): sample prepared from aluminum isopropoxide, H3PO4, HF, piperidine, powder (determination of cell and structural parameters)
Substance Summary
- Standard Formula: Al[PO4]
- Alphabetic Formula: Al[PO4]
- Published Formula: AlPO4; AlPO-34
- Refined Formula: AlO4P
- Wyckoff Sequence: 148,f6
- Z Formula Units: 18
- Density: ρ = 1.49 Mg·m−3
